Be aware that the NHS waiting time for ADHD tests is based on your ability to be referred by your GP. This is called the "Referral to Treatment" (RTT) clock. The clock starts when the hospital receives the referral letter. You can stop the timer by asking your GP for a referral at a convenient time.
The first step is a mental health assessment with a psychologist or psychiatrist as they are the only professionals to diagnose ADHD. The test can be conducted in person or through video calls and usually takes 45-90 min. During the examination, you will be asked to provide information about your family background as well as any mental health issues you may have. This will enable the doctor to determine if you have ADHD.
In certain areas of the UK, waiting times for ADHD assessments are very long. The latest figures obtained through Freedom of Information requests, show that patients have waited up to four years for an appointment. This is a significant increase over the previous figures. The longest wait time for an appointment was at Cwm Taf Morgannwg University Health Board. They waited 182 week.
Certain medical professionals have preconceived notions of what an individual with ADHD is like, which can make it more difficult to evaluate the person accurately. This is often the cause of patients not receiving the attention they need. If you are a woman or a person of color, it may make it difficult to obtain the proper diagnosis.

The majority of private ADHD assessments involve a conversation between a psychiatrist or psychologist. They will ask you questions about your behaviour and how it affects your work and family life. They will also ask you about your symptoms as a kid. The assessment is usually planned and takes between two sessions to complete. It may be helpful to bring a friend or family member to the interview.

Private healthcare providers have their own policies about whether they require a written confirmation from a GP or not. It is crucial to verify this prior to booking. Some providers offer a shared-care agreement with your GP which can save you money on the cost of private prescriptions.
To be diagnosed as having ADHD you must see a psychiatrist or an ADHD specialist nurse. Psychiatrists and special ADHD nurses have received specialized training in the condition. Other mental health professionals, including counsellors, are not able to diagnose ADHD.
